Title
JOINT USE PARTNERSHIP BETWEEN RECREATION AND PARKS AND LAUSD
Subject
Motion - Joint use possibilities between the Department of Recreation and Parks and the Los Angeles Unified School District (LAUSD) have recently been discussed and considered by City Councilmembers and the Mayor. Currently, several LAUSD schools have some sort of joint use agreement with the City. Some examples include the use of sports fields by either partY, gymnasiums, and parking lots. Past Council actions have encouraged development of joint use projects between various City entities and LAUSD. Joint use partnerships between LAUSD and the Department of Recreation and Parks could address and help fulfill the goals of both schools and parks, and a joint venture between Recreation and Parks and LAUSD would allow both to work together to define and fulfill student and department needs. Joint use ventures could strengthen both schools and parks by incorporating events and uses for both students and park visitors. Such joint use partnerships could serve to expand the functionality and availability of parks and recreation space while also providing valuable services to LAUSD schools. THEREFORE MOVE that the Department of Recreation and Parks, in consultation with the Los Angeles Unified School District, be directed to report to the Arts, Parks, Health, and Aging and Audits Committees on joint use possibilities between City parks and City schools.
